Bible Verses about 'Satisfy'

For I have satiated the weary soul, and I have replenished every sorrowful soul.For I give plenty of water to the weary ones, and refresh everyone who languishes.
And my God shall supply all your need according to His riches in glory by Christ Jesus.And my God will supply all your needs according to His riches in glory in Christ Jesus.
Remove falsehood and lies far from me; Give me neither poverty nor riches— Feed me with the food allotted to me.Keep deception and lies far from me, Give me neither poverty nor riches; Feed me with the food that is my portion.
For you, brethren, have been called to liberty; only do not use liberty as an opportunity for the flesh, but through love serve one another.For you were called to freedom, brothers and sisters; only do not turn your freedom into an opportunity for the flesh, but serve one another through love.
For he who sows to his flesh will of the flesh reap corruption, but he who sows to the Spirit will of the Spirit reap everlasting life.For the one who sows to his own flesh will reap destruction from the flesh, but the one who sows to the Spirit will reap eternal life from the Spirit.

A man has joy by the answer of his mouth, And a word spoken in due season, how good it is!A person has joy in an apt answer, And how delightful is a timely word!
The thief does not come except to steal, and to kill, and to destroy. I have come that they may have life, and that they may have it more abundantly.The thief comes only to steal and kill and destroy; I came so that they would have life, and have it abundantly.
If you turn away your foot from the Sabbath, From doing your pleasure on My holy day, And call the Sabbath a delight, The holy day of the Lord honorable, And shall honor Him, not doing your own ways, Nor finding your own pleasure, Nor speaking your own words, Then you shall delight yourself in the Lord; And I will cause you to ride on the high hills of the earth, And feed you with the heritage of Jacob your father. The mouth of the Lord has spoken.If, because of the Sabbath, you restrain your foot From doing as you wish on My holy day, And call the Sabbath a pleasure, and the holy day of the Lord honorable, And honor it, desisting from your own ways, From seeking your own pleasure And speaking your own word, Then you will take delight in the Lord, And I will make you ride on the heights of the earth; And I will feed you with the heritage of Jacob your father, For the mouth of the Lord has spoken.
For He satisfies the longing soul, And fills the hungry soul with goodness.For He has satisfied the thirsty soul, And He has filled the hungry soul with what is good.
My son, do not forget my law, But let your heart keep my commands; For length of days and long life And peace they will add to you.My son, do not forget my teaching, But have your heart comply with my commandments; For length of days and years of life And peace they will add to you.
He who loves silver will not be satisfied with silver; Nor he who loves abundance, with increase. This also is vanity.One who loves money will not be satisfied with money, nor one who loves abundance with its income. This too is futility.
